ABOUT THE ROLE:
- Contribute to our event-driven Microservice Architecture (currently 200+ services owned by 40+ teams). You will define and maintain the services your team owns (you design it, you build it, you run it, you scale it globally)
- Use Java 17, Spring Boot and JOOQ to build your services.
- Expose and consume RESTful APIs. We value good API design and we treat our APIs as Products (in the world of Open Banking often times they are gonna be public!)
- Use SNS+SQS and Kafka to send events
- Utilise PostgreSQL via Aurora as your primary datastore (we are heavy AWS users)
- Deploy your services to Production as often as you need to (this usually means multiple times per day!). This is enabled by our CI/CD pipelines powered by GitHub with GitHub actions, and solid JUnit/Pact testing (new joiners are encouraged to have something deployed to production in their first 2 weeks)
- Experience modern GitOps using ArgoCD. Our Cloud team uses Docker, Terraform, EKS/Kubernetes to run the platform.
- Have DataDog as your best friend to monitor your services and investigate issues
- Collaborate closely with Product Owners to understand our Users’ needs, Business opportunities and Regulatory requirements and translate them into well-engineered solutions
W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R:
- Have some experience building server-side applications and detailed knowledge of the relevant programming languages for your stack. You don’t need to know Java, but bear in mind that most of our services are written in Java, so you need to be willing to learn it when you have to change something there!
- Have a sound knowledge of a backend framework (e.g. Spring/Spring Boot) that you’ve used to write microservices that expose and consume RESTful APIs
- Have experience engineering scalable and reliable solutions in a cloud-native environment (the most important thing for us is understanding the fundamentals of CI/CD, practical Agile so to speak)
- Demonstrate a mindset of delivering secure, well-tested and well-documented software that integrates with various third party providers and partners (we do that a lot in the fintech industry)
